Barringer Academic Center

Barringer Academic Center is located in Charlotte, North Carolina. This school is a public school with grade levels Kindergarten through Fifth Grade.

There are approximately 714 students at this school. There are 31 teachers. This makes the student to teacher ratio 23 students to 1 teacher. The national average is 15 which means this school has more students in the classroom than most.

There are 107 students in Kindergarten, 95 in Grade 1, 122 in Grade 2, 147 in Grade 3, 121 in Grade 4, 122 in Grade 5 . Third Grade has the highest number of enrolled students. In this school there are 336 male students and 378 female students making the female students exceed the number of male students in this school. The student ethnic body is comprised of 181 white students, 34 asian/pacific islander, 9 hispanic, 485 african american students and 5 native american students. More ...

The student economic level is above average. Only 392 students out of the 714 student population receive free or reduced lunch or 54.9% of the students. This school is not a title 1 school. This means this school did not receive any federal assistance. More ...
